Among all household pests, termites are easily the most destructive. They feed on wood and cellulose materials, slowly but surely damaging the core of your home’s structure, making them one of the most serious threats to any property. And, if a colony decides to establish itself near your home, that danger comes directly to your doorstep. Residential properties are prime spots for bed bugs. They thrive in areas with fabrics and cloth items where they can conceal themselves. Bed bugs are minuscule and often go unnoticed. Even if you notice bites or irritation, finding the bed bugs can be difficult.

In most cases, the Brown Recluse you’ll find in South Haven, IN isn’t very large. Typically, the brown recluse measures between 0.5 to 1 inch in size. It can be identified by its noticeable brown color and the dark stripe running down its back. It’s often said that this stripe resembles the shape of a violin, which is why the brown recluse is often called the brown fiddler.
